
On paper, drayage looks easy enough. Pick up a container at the port and get it to a transloading facility or a warehouse. What could go wrong, right? But in Southern California, it is not so straightforward. The ports of Los Angeles and Long Beach handle about 31% of all U.S. ocean trade. If you partner with the wrong drayage partner in such an environment, it can lead to missed terminal appointments, high demurrage and detention fees, and unnecessary per diem fees due to poor planning.
But with the right drayage partner, your containers will keep moving, your costs will be low, and your operations will be on schedule. In this article, we explain the five operational traits that separate a high-performance drayage from one that just owns a few trucks near the port.Â
The first thing most shippers want to know is the size of the fleet. However, the better question is whether that fleet can handle your volume during the busiest time of year without having to hire subcarriers you don’t know. A high-performance drayage partner has a fleet that includes day cabs for short turns, yard tractors for container staging, and sufficient capacity to move both standard and overweight containers.
Managing the chassis is a big part of this. The supply of chassis in Southern California has been a recurring bottleneck for years. For instance, when there is an import surge, the average dwell time of a chassis can go as high as seven days, creating a compounding shortage across the port complex. But if you partner with a drayage provider like Golden State Logistics, which owns its own chassis pool, you won’t have to worry about chassis shortages or compete with other shippers for the same limited equipment.
In California, not every drayage fleet is permitted to move a container weighing more than 44,000 pounds. Those loads need tri-axle chassis, three-axle or four-axle tractors, and permits for the LA/Long Beach overweight corridor. If your partner can’t handle those moves in-house, you’re adding a second carrier, a second invoice, and a second point of failure.
Find out how well the fleet did during the last busy season. Could they scale capacity by 30-50% without service issues? The answer provides more information than the number of trucks listed on their website.
The location, size, and equipment of your drayage partner’s yard directly affect how quickly your freight moves through Southern California. Take, for example, a yard located 5 to 15 miles from the terminals. The shorter distance means shorter dray turns, faster chassis returns, and lower fuel costs per move. Meanwhile, for a yard 40 miles inland, you can expect at least an hour of drive time in both directions. That extra hour could mean the difference between getting a chassis back on time or paying for another day of per diem.
Container staging capability is another important factor. There may be days when your warehouse isn’t ready to receive shipments, or customs may place a hold on your cargo. Your drayage partner’s yard should be able to keep those containers safe until the next move is ready. This way, you are not stuck paying demurrage and per diem because your container is stuck on a chassis longer than anticipated.
Some shipments require grounded container handling. But that takes a lot of yard space and heavy equipment, such as top picks, side picks, or reach stackers. If the drayage yard cannot do this, you will be limited in your ability to handle holds and delays.
Pulling containers early from the terminal and staging them at the yard before the delivery appointment can help you avoid demurrage during congestion. But that only works if the yard has enough space and the right tools to handle the traffic. A drayage partner with a yard near the port, well-equipped and well-located, gives you options a partner without one can’t.
In Southern California, port drayage is not the same as driving a regional route or hauling dry freight on the highway. The person driving through a terminal gate, whether at Pier T, TraPac, or Fenix Marine, needs to know exactly how each terminal operates. Every terminal has different rules for gate procedures, chassis flips, trouble ticket processes, appointments, and so on. A driver who knows the routine can pick up a container 30 minutes to an hour faster than a driver learning on the job.
Drivers who do drayage in the LA/Long Beach area have very short windows. A driver might have to pick up a container at 7 a.m., drop it off at a transloading facility by 10 a.m., and then return the chassis before the clock runs out. Experienced drivers know how to plan their moves so they don’t have to wait too long and stay compliant without wasting hours sitting in a terminal line.
Good drayage drivers keep dispatch up to date without being asked. They call when there is a problem with the chassis, a delay at the terminal, or a receiver who isn’t ready. That real-time information feeds directly into your visibility system, which brings us to the next point.
For drayage operations in Southern California, good communication means sending automated updates on container status (picked up, in transit, delivered, empty returned), notifications of estimated arrival times to receivers, alerts for exceptions when something goes wrong, and proof-of-delivery paperwork the same day — all of which you can expect from a high-performance drayage partner.
The people using the technology also matter. For example, with a dashboard, you can tell your shipment is behind schedule. But a good dispatcher will call the receiver, change the appointment, work with the terminal, and keep the freight on track before your team even knows there is a problem. That human response layer, along with real-time data from GPS and ELD systems, is what makes a tech-equipped carrier different from one that really uses the technology.
Your supply chain will flow or stop depending on how well your drayage partner connects to the next step in the process. The ideal scenario is to have the drayage provider and the transloading facility be the same company or at least very close partners. That way, there is little to no gap between “container delivered” and “container unloaded” because control is maintained between pickup and transload.
There is also no confusion about the appointment times. So, when the container arrives, it is emptied, and the items are sorted onto domestic trailers the same day. That speed keeps the chassis moving and the free time from running out.
The same thing happens with the inland transportation handoff. After transloading, freight needs to move. A drayage partner that also handles inland transportation, or works with a dedicated inland carrier, can handle the entire process, from pickup at the port to delivery to the final destination. When you are dealing with one partner for all of these, there are fewer places for information to get lost.
And then there’s the step that most shippers forget about until they get the bill: returning empty containers. Your drayage partner should have a clear plan for returning empty containers during the carrier’s free time. That means you need to know which terminals take empty containers on which days, during which shifts, and with which steamship line rules.
Every time drayage, transloading, and inland transport are not connected, there is a risk of delay. And in Southern California, those delays cost real money in the form of demurrage fees, per diem charges, missed delivery windows, and extra warehouse hours. But the fewer gaps in the chain, the less you pay for things that should not have gone wrong in the first place.
Shippers that choose a drayage partner based solely on price often end up paying more in fees, delays, and missed appointments than they save on the rate.
